Featured will be Welsh baritone Jeremy Huw Williams and University of Arizona Associate Professor of Practice in Piano Daniel Linder.
Their program will include George Butterworth’s Six Songs from a Shropshire Lad a cycle which reflects on the lives of British soldiers who died in the service of Queen Victoria paired with Pines’ Last Poems; a new cycle by Tucson-based composer Daniel Asia which confronts impending mortality the ambiguity of Spring and death and memories of the Vietnam War.
Williams and Linder will also perform a selection of Welsh folk song arrangements by Benjamin Britten a lively selection of Cabaret Songs by William Bolcom and a world premiere setting of Psalm 13 by Joshua Nichols. Guitarist Pablo Gonzalez will also perform with Jeremy a world premiere by Zachary James Bramble.
